Forming an LLC Company in KSA: Legal Requirements and Procedures

LLC company formation in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ia (KSA) is a process that involves several steps. Individuals seeking to establish an LLC must comply with specific legal mandates.

A key prerequisite for LLC formation is obtaining a commercial license from the Ministry of Commerce and Investment (MCI). This process typically involves submitting a business plan and other required documents.

Moreover, LLCs in KSA must have at least one Saudi partner. The authorized investment for an LLC is also a factor that needs to be defined during the formation procedure.

To ensure compliance with KSA's legal framework, it is highly recommended to seek professional guidance from a qualified lawyer or business consultant. They can provide valuable expertise on the specific conditions for LLC formation and help navigate the obstacles involved.
